A recap on differences between fontina and sunflower oil

  • Fontina has more vitamin B12, calcium, phosphorus, zinc, selenium, and vitamin A; however, sunflower oil is higher in vitamin E.
  • Sunflower oil covers your daily vitamin E needs 272% more than fontina.
  • Sunflower oil has less cholesterol.
  • The glycemic index of fontina is higher.

Food varieties used in this article are Cheese, fontina and Oil, sunflower, linoleic, (partially hydrogenated).

All nutrients comparison - raw data values

Nutrient Fontina Sunflower oil DV% diff.
Vitamin E 0.27mg 41.08mg 272%
Polyunsaturated fat 1.654g 36.4g 232%
Fats 31.14g 100g 106%
Monounsaturated fat 8.687g 46.2g 94%
Vitamin B12 1.68µg 0µg 70%
Calcium 550mg 0mg 55%
Protein 25.6g 0g 51%
Phosphorus 346mg 0mg 49%
Cholesterol 116mg 0mg 39%
Sodium 800mg 0mg 35%
Zinc 3.5mg 0mg 32%
Vitamin A 261µg 0µg 29%
Saturated fat 19.196g 13g 28%
Selenium 14.5µg 0µg 26%
Calories 389kcal 884kcal 25%
Vitamin B2 0.204mg 0mg 16%
Vitamin B5 0.429mg 0mg 9%
Vitamin B6 0.083mg 0mg 6%
Copper 0.025mg 0mg 3%
Choline 15.4mg 3%
Iron 0.23mg 0mg 3%
Vitamin D 0.6µg 3%
Magnesium 14mg 0mg 3%
Vitamin D 23IU 3%
Folate 6µg 0µg 2%
Vitamin K 2.6µg 5.4µg 2%
Vitamin B1 0.021mg 0mg 2%
Potassium 64mg 0mg 2%
Vitamin B3 0.15mg 0mg 1%
Manganese 0.014mg 0mg 1%
Carbs 1.55g 0g 1%
Net carbs 1.55g 0g N/A
Sugar 1.55g 0g N/A
